What to check before for buildings with low open violation rates near the M21 bus in NYC

  • Use the M21 filter to keep your commute corridor in mind, then compare the specific violation signal for each building.
  • Before applying, request the unit’s current condition notes in writing (paint, pests, heat, hot water) and confirm when any prior issues were addressed.
  • Treat “low violations” as a starting signal, not a guarantee. Open-record data can lag real-world conditions.
  • Check lease terms that affect risk and cost: timing of maintenance, work-order process, and any fees related to repairs or move-in conditions.
  • When you shortlist a building, look for recent tenant feedback that matches your priorities (maintenance speed, landlord communication, cleanliness).
